Optimization and queueing networks: keynote 1

Published: 29 July 2009 Publication History

Abstract

Recently, there has been much progress in understanding the connection between optimization and control of queueing networks. In this talk, we will focus on two applications to wireless networks. One application is to a network whose traffic consists of a mixture of persistent and transient flows. We will use the connection between Lagrange multipliers and queues to derive a new version of the max-weight scheduling algorithm which stabilizes the queues in this network. The other application is to a network with a mixture of elastic and inelastic flows where the inelastic flow's packets have strict deadlines. Again, exploiting the connection between queueing networks and optimization, we will derive a scheduling algorithm that fairly allocates the network resources among the elastic flows while ensuring that the deadline constraints are met for the inelastic flows. The talk is based on joint work with Shihuan Liu, Lei Ying and Juan Jose Jaramillo.
